Ticket: session tokens on Driftly aren't refreshing before expiry — users get bounced to login roughly every 55 minutes. Looks like the refresh worker compares expiry in local time instead of UTC, so it fires an hour late. Fix is in the auth-refresh branch; please review the clock handling carefully. To reproduce against the token service in staging, authenticate with the key below.

gateway credential: kto23_LX9A4ys6i4nzHtpOLNLodKK

Runbook: account recovery during Cartwheel load tests

Heads up, support crew — while we hammer the Cartwheel checkout flow with synthetic traffic, some test shopper accounts will lock themselves out (the rate limiter can't tell bots from our bots). Don't escalate these; just run the standard recovery flow against the staging identity service. If the flow asks for a second factor, pick the offline option. When prompted to re-key the test account's recovery wallet, enter the passphrase shown below.

unlock words, hahip-baduf: holwyn-istath-julvan

Hey plugin folks — we've spotted configuration drift on the Hollowmere export service. Some installs are still running the old retry settings (3 attempts, fixed delay) while newer ones use backoff with jitter, so failed exports replay at wildly different rates depending on where your plugin runs. If your plugin hooks the retry events, please test against the canonical settings, not whatever your sandbox happens to have. The canonical values we're converging everything to are below.

config for haweg-bagag:
[kasath]
host = kasath.qirvancorp.internal
user = kasath_svc
database = kasath_prod